In it we meet a cast of obsessed and unstable ex- geeks overcompensating for their prior lack of social skills by working together to trade techniques and help each other in the field, i.e., trying to pick up chicks. The story is about Strauss' personal journey into (and out of) the inter- networked society of pickup artists (PUAs).

    The chapter numbers are represented as dice. Inside, each chapter begins with a white-on-black pithy quote relating to the events in the section, and an incongruous illustration featuring Strauss (megalomania, anyone?) in some straight-out-of-an- RPG-corebook situation with a Hot Babe or two.     The first printing is Yapp style, bound in faux-leather black softback and rounded, gilt edges, with a spine-bound red ribbon bookmark. When I first removed it from the packaging I was amazed at the chutzpah of the book designers. And the previews of The Game: Penetrating the Secret Society of Pickup Artists made it seem like this was a well-written how-to manual.
